b087538119
This makes it easier to spot syntax errors when editing the class reference. The schema is referenced locally so validation can still work offline. Each class XML's schema conformance is also checked on GitHub Actions.
24 lines
866 B
XML
24 lines
866 B
XML
<?xml version="1.0" encoding="UTF-8" ?>
|
|
<class name="VisualScriptSwitch" inherits="VisualScriptNode" version="3.5"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="../../../doc/class.xsd">
|
|
<brief_description>
|
|
Branches program flow based on a given input's value.
|
|
</brief_description>
|
|
<description>
|
|
Branches the flow based on an input's value. Use [b]Case Count[/b] in the Inspector to set the number of branches and each comparison's optional type.
|
|
[b]Input Ports:[/b]
|
|
- Sequence: [code]'input' is[/code]
|
|
- Data (variant): [code]=[/code]
|
|
- Data (variant): [code]=[/code] (optional)
|
|
- Data (variant): [code]input[/code]
|
|
[b]Output Ports:[/b]
|
|
- Sequence
|
|
- Sequence (optional)
|
|
- Sequence: [code]done[/code]
|
|
</description>
|
|
<tutorials>
|
|
</tutorials>
|
|
<methods>
|
|
</methods>
|
|
<constants>
|
|
</constants>
|
|
</class>
|